The DeFi PULSE site is an excellent place to check the performance of a Yield Farming project. This index reflects the total value of cryptocurrencies locked in DeFi lending platforms. It also includes the total liquidity in DeFi liquidity pools. Investors often use the TVL Index to analyze Yield Farming investments. You can find this index on the DEFI PULSE site. This index's growth indicates investors are optimistic about this type of project.
Yield farming is an investment strategy that uses decentralized platforms to provide liquidity to projects. Yield farming lets investors make a substantial amount of cryptocurrency with idle tokens, which is different from traditional banks. This strategy is based on smart contracts and decentralized exchanges, which allow investors automate financial transactions between two parties. In return for investing in a yield farm, an investor can earn transaction fees, governance tokens, and interest from a lending platform.

A metric to assess the health and performance of a platform
It is crucial to establish a metric that measures the health of a yield farm platform. Yield farming is the process by which you can earn rewards from cryptocurrency holdings. This process could be compared to staking. Yield-farming platforms work with liquidity suppliers, who then add funds to liquidity pool. Liquidity providers earn a reward for providing liquidity, usually from the platform's fees.

Liquidity, a key metric to measure the health and performance of a yield farming platform, is one. Yield farming is an automated market-maker model that uses liquidity mining. In addition to cryptocurrencies and tokens, yield farming platforms offer tokens which are tied to USD or another stablecoin. Liquidity providers get rewards based upon the amount they provide in funds and the protocol rules that govern trading costs.
